ignorant
/ˈɪɡnərənt/
adjective
- Lacking knowledge or awareness about a particular subject or situation.
- I was ignorant of the fact that the store closed early on Sundays.
- He remained ignorant of the surprise party until he walked through the door.
- Many people are ignorant of how their food gets from the farm to the table.
- Uneducated or uninformed in general; showing a lack of knowledge.
- She felt ignorant compared to her classmates who had studied abroad.
- The movie made fun of ignorant tourists who didn't know local customs.
- An ignorant remark like that only shows how little you understand the issue.
- Rude or discourteous, especially because of a lack of understanding or awareness.
- His ignorant comments about her culture offended everyone at the table.
- It was ignorant of him to talk loudly on the phone during the movie.
- Don't be so ignorant — apologize for interrupting her speech.
